A brief summary of the game ...........The SPL's worst centre back gives Rangers hope early on.  Encouraged by the no surrender ringing out from the stands they get wired in but Celtic start to boss the midfield and never seem to panic and pull things back with a goal just before the break which knocks the stuffing out of Rangers . Celtic come out after the break and continue to dominate midfield . Gollum and the Tory then step in to  try to even things a bit by sending off Simunovic but that doesn't help much as Celtic just tighten the midfield even further .  Rangers huff and puff but start to lose their shape . Edouard is then introduced to rumble things up and he duly delivers to score an individual effort to silence Derry's walls.  From then on , Celtic just sat in and Rangers failed to break them down until a wee lapse let in the worst and most overpriced striker to ............fuckin miss again two mins from the end.  Game over. 

From a neutral point of view it was an enthralling encounter though.  Far better than that tame effort from down south yesterday lunchtime.
